Output 91af317e4bc009d87d56375c1953a668b42ea05761c93032941e2eac51054de5:17

value
89909
script pubkey
OP_0 OP_PUSHBYTES_20 ac61772d80f45a45a3cd041bb85b2a07e1ee6bcb
address
bc1q43shwtvq73dytg7dqsdmske2qls7u67tnvxfwv
transaction
91af317e4bc009d87d56375c1953a668b42ea05761c93032941e2eac51054de5